The Variation of Snow Cover and Its Relationship to Air Temperature and Precipitation in Liaoning Province during 1961-2007

Based on the observational data of first snow cover date,last snow cover date and snow cover duration,together with temperature and precipitation data,from 52 base stations of Liaoning province from 1961 to 2007,the variation characteristics of snow cover and the relationship between snow cover and climate are analyzed.The analyses show that the average first snow cover date was about on November 19,the average last snow cover date was on March 23,and the snow cover duration lasted for 125 days on average in Liaoning province.In the 47 years,the first snow cover date had no significant change,but the last snow cover date was put forward about 13 days,mainly in the southern coastal areas of the province,while snow cover duration was shortened about 13 days,mainly in the central,the most part of the east and some areas of the north of Liaoning province.In the 47 years,the first snow cover date had an abrupt change in 1998,the last snow cover date had two abrupt changes in 1974 and 1992,and the snow cover duration had no significant abrupt change.The first snow cover date,last snow cover date and snow cover duration had a cycle variation.The first snow cover date related well with meteorological factors in November and was controlled by the starting date of 0℃,and the last snow cover date related better with meteorological factors in April than that in other months,and strongly correlated with the ending date of 10℃.The first snow cover date and last snow cover date were more sensitive to temperature than to precipitation,and as to temperature,they were more tightly depended on the average surface temperature rather than on average air temperature.The lower the temperature was and the more the precipitation was,the longer the duration of snow cover.Temperature is more important for maintaining snow cover.
